The invention discloses an energy storage type tramcar charging and discharging control method and device and a medium, relates to the field of rail transit, and simplifies the charging and discharging control process in a hybrid power supply system. A train control management system monitors the current running state, the current electricity taking state, the current voltage state of a super capacitor and the current energy storage state of a power lithium battery; the bidirectional direct-current converter is controlled to charge when a charging condition is met, the bidirectional direct-current converter is controlled to discharge when a discharging condition is met, the train control management system is responsible for collecting state data and performing logic calculation according to a train running state, and multi-stage transmission and logic processing of data among all component systems are cancelled; a data transmission path is optimized, charging and discharging actions of the hybrid power supply system are comprehensively controlled, charging and discharging control under different working conditions is achieved, and timeliness and economical efficiency of train operation are improved.
